   Non-Convex Cost and Revenue Efficiency Analysis in Two-Stage Networks and Its Application to Iranian Airlines

چکیده    In the real word, the decision maker may want to use revenue and cost efficiency analysis for existing units compared to virtual units, traditional dea models can no longer be used and fdh models must be used to evaluate the efficiency of decision-making units. in this paper, we develop the revenue and cost efficiency models based on the fdh model and obtain the efficiency scores based on pair wise comparisons. in the following, we will develop the proposed models for the two-stage network structure and obtain the desired scores of inputs and outputs by considering the input and output prices. an algorithm for measuring the revenue and cost efficiency is presented based on the ratio of inputs and outputs. finally, we use the proposed algorithm to evaluate the efficiency of 13 airports in iran with a two-stage network structure without considering the constraint of convexity and present the results of the research.
کلیدواژه DEA; Free Disposal Hull; Cost and Revenue efficiency; Airlines; Two-stage network
